Where to Find Idaho Pasture Pigs for Sale?
This is often the first and most important question. Several avenues exist for finding pasture-raised pigs in Idaho:
-
Local Farmers Markets: Check your local farmers' markets. Many small-scale farmers sell their pigs directly to consumers, offering a great opportunity to meet the farmer, learn about their practices, and select your pigs in person. This allows you to ask questions about their diet, living conditions, and overall health.
-
Online Classifieds (Craigslist, Facebook Marketplace): These platforms are treasure troves for finding local sellers. Be sure to carefully vet potential sellers, asking questions about their farming practices and requesting photos and videos of the pigs.
-
Directly Contacting Farms: Many farms in Idaho specialize in raising pasture pigs. Researching farms in your area and contacting them directly can yield excellent results. Look for farms that emphasize sustainable and humane practices.
-
Agricultural Organizations: Check with your local agricultural extension office or farming organizations in Idaho. They may have resources or lists of local farmers who raise pasture pigs.
What to Look for When Buying Pasture Pigs in Idaho
Finding the right pigs is crucial. Consider these factors:
-
Breed: Different breeds have varying characteristics. Some are known for their meat quality, others for their hardiness, and still others for their temperament. Research breeds to find the best fit for your needs and experience level.
-
Age and Weight: The age and weight of the pigs will depend on your purpose. Are you looking for piglets to raise, feeder pigs to finish, or mature breeding stock?
-
Health: Examine the pigs carefully for any signs of illness or injury. Ask the seller about their vaccination and deworming practices. Healthy pigs are active, alert, and have clean coats.
-
Farming Practices: Inquire about the farmer's pasture management techniques. Do they rotate pastures to prevent overgrazing and parasite buildup? What do they feed their pigs? Sustainable and humane practices are key.

What questions should I ask a seller before purchasing pasture-raised pigs in Idaho?
Before committing to a purchase, ask these crucial questions:
- What breed are the pigs?
- What is their age and weight?
- What is their diet?
- What are their vaccination and deworming protocols?
- Can I see the pigs in their pasture environment?
- What is your return policy if the pigs are unwell upon arrival?
- What is included in the purchase price (e.g., transportation)?
